Feature Comparison: Innova 3100j vs. Autel Battery Testers
While both tools offer battery testing capabilities, Autel offers a broader range of diagnostic tools, some including battery testing as part of their comprehensive functionality. The Innova 3100j primarily focuses on battery and charging system diagnostics, providing features like:
- Battery Health Analysis: Determines the overall condition of the battery, including state of charge, cold cranking amps (CCA), and voltage.
- Charging System Test: Evaluates the alternator’s performance and identifies potential issues with the charging system.
- Starter Test: Checks the starter motor’s draw and identifies potential starting problems.
- OBD2 Diagnostics: Provides access to di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s) related to the engine and emissions systems. However, its OBD2 functionality is more limited compared to dedicated OBD2 scanners.
Autel, on the other hand, offers various devices, from dedicated battery testers to high-end diagnostic tablets. Autel battery testers typically include features such as:
- Conductance Testing: Measures the battery’s ability to conduct current, providing a more accurate assessment of its health.
- System Testing: Assesses the entire starting and charging system, including the battery, alternator, and starter.
- Advanced Diagnostics: Depending on the specific Autel model, advanced features like battery registration and module coding may be available. Note that this is usually found on their higher-end diagnostic tablets.
Vehicle Coverage: Autel’s Comprehensive Database
A key differentiator between the Innova 3100j and Autel battery tools is vehicle coverage. Innova historically had limitations in covering newer vehicle models. While recent updates have extended their coverage to include more recent vehicles, Autel generally boasts a more comprehensive database, covering a wider range of makes and models, including domestic, Asian, and European vehicles. Autel’s regular updates ensure compatibility with the latest car models.
Innova has addressed previous concerns regarding limited vehicle coverage with software updates. However, ensuring your Innova 3100j has the latest update is essential for optimal vehicle compatibility. Refer to Innova’s website and coverage checker for the most up-to-date information.
